Transaction 5642e333a3c9c21f298f4899e5044363422de55ad4aee650d970372e572c8055
1 Input
1 Outputs
- 5642e333a3c9c21f298f4899e5044363422de55ad4aee650d970372e572c8055:0
value 50794
address mqtLB1ZGgufvSCtFfoMb4Bji9GeoQar4VU